This pool was initialized to allocate single pages, which was sufficient as long as the device sector size did not exceed the PAGE_SIZE. Given that block layer now supports block size upto 64K ie beyond PAGE_SIZE, adapt sd_set_special_bvec() to accommodate that. With the above fix, enable sector sizes > PAGE_SIZE in scsi sd driver.
